Languagism

noun

noun ·Rare ·Advanced level

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    Linguicism; discrimination or chauvinism based on features of language such as accent, syntax, or vocabulary. rare, uncountable

    "The reactionary elements in the country have had their days in poisoning the minds of most of the city people. It is in the shape of communalism, communism and languagism."
